COVID-19: Court Orders Release of El-Zakzaky’s Wife

Posted by Thandiubani on Mon 25th Jan, 2021 - tori.ng

As a result of the dreaded coronavirus disease, a court in Kaduna state has ordered the release of Shiekh Ibrahim Elzakzaky's wife.

Zeenat, the wife of Shiekh Ibrahim Elzakzaky has been ordered to be released.
 
The order for her release was given by a High Court sitting in Kaduna.
 
Elzakzaky is the leader of Islamic Movement in Nigeria, IMN.
 
Zeenat is to be released to undergo treatment after contracting coronavirus.
 
It will be recalled that last Thursday, Mohammed, son of the IMN leader, said his mother, Zeenat, tested positive for COVID-19 at the Kaduna correctional centre, where he demanded for her release for treatment and authority refused.
 
Femi Falana, counsel to El-Zakzaky, however presented a medical report to back up his case for the release of Zeenat.
 
The Senior Advocate of Nigeria (SAN) asked the court to allow Zeenat seek medical treatment outside the correctional centre according to measures put in place by the Nigeria Centre for Disease Control (NCDC).
 
In the ruling delivered on Monday, the court however asked that, Zeenat be moved to a government isolation facility to begin treatment immediately.
 
Gideon Kurada, the presiding judge, granted the request after Chris Umar, the prosecuting counsel, concurred with Falana’s submission.
 
The Controller of Kaduna Correctional Service, Ibrahim Labbo Maradun had Friday last week denied the report of Zakzaky’s testing positive. He said the result of her test was still being awaited as at Friday.
 
Meanwhile, the test result obtained by The Nation, stamped by the Kaduna State Ministry of Health COVID-19 Laboratory on 20th January, 2021, shows that the IMN leader’s wife is COVID-19 positive.
